The V-Plex Human Chemokine Panel 1 is a multiplex immunoassay kit that allows for the simultaneous quantitative measurement of multiple human chemokine proteins in a single sample. It is designed for use with the V-PLEX platform.

Multiplex ELISA for Secreted Chemokines and Cytokines

Secreted chemokines and proinflammatory cytokines were quantified from the basolateral samples of both low and high MOI infections using multiplex ELISAs (MesoScale Diagnostics): V-PLEX Human Chemokine Panel 1 (Eotaxin, Eotaxin-3, IP-10 (CXCL10), MCP-1, MCP-4, MDC, MIP-1α, MIP-1β, TARC, IL-8) and Human ProInflammatory Tissue Culture 9-Plex (GM-CSF, IFN-γ, IL-1β, IL-10, IL-12p70, IL-2, IL-6, IL-8, TNF-α), respectively, following manufacturer instructions. Samples were diluted 1:2 for the proinflammatory cytokine panel and 1:4 for the chemokine panel in the provided reagent diluents and run in duplicate. Plates were washed as described above. All incubations were performed sealed at room temperature with shaking (3000 rpm). Before reading, 2x read buffer was added and the plates were incubated for 5 minutes (ProInflammatory 9-Plex) or read immediately (Chemokine Panel 1 V-Plex) on a Meso Scale Discovery SECTOR Imager 2400. Protein concentrations were calculated using the MesoScale Diagnostics Discovery Workbench (version 4.0.12).

Profiling Virus-Induced Secreted Immune Factors

Secreted interferons, cytokines, and chemokines were quantified from the apical and basolateral samples from the 48 and 96 hour post infection samples from the hNEC multistep virus growth curves. Measurements were performed using the V-PLEX Human Chemokine Panel 1 (CCL2, CCL3, CCL4, CCL11, CCL13, CCL17, CCL22, CCL26, CXCL10, and IL-8), V-PLEX Human IL-6 kit (Meso Scale Discovery), and the DIY Human IFN Lambda 1/2/3 (IL-29/28A/28B) ELISA (PBL Assay Science) according to manufacturers’ instructions. Of the 12 analytes tested, 10 (CCL2, CCL3, CCL4, CCL11, CCL17, CCL22, CXCL10, IL-8, IL-6, and IFN-λ) were specifically induced in virus-infected cultures. The amount secreted was adjusted by sample volume (either 100 or 150 μl for the apical washes, 500 μl for the basolateral supernatants) to show total pg secreted.

Quantification of Immune Mediators in hNEC Infections

Secreted interferons, cytokines, and chemokines were quantified from the basolateral samples at 48 and 96 h post-infection for hNEC infections. Measurements were performed using the V-Plex Human Chemokine Panel 1 (CCL2, CCL3, CCL4, CCL11, CCL17, CCL22, CCL26, CXCL10, and IL-8; Meso Scale Discovery, Rockville, MD, USA) and the DIY Human IFN Lambda 1/2/3 (IL-29/28A/28B) ELISA (PBL Assay Science, Piscataway, NJ. USA) according to the manufacturers’ instructions. This panel has been used previously to characterize IAV infections of epithelial cells [39 (link),44 (link),45 (link)]. Each sample was analyzed in duplicate. Heatmaps were generated and hierarchical clustering was performed using the R package “pheatmap” [46 ].
